May 8, 1959 – September 5, 2022

Jeffrey Thomas Niemi, 63, of Naples, FL, passed away on September 5th with his wife and kids by his side after a valiant battle with esophageal cancer.

Born on May 8th, 1959 to Albert Thomas and Kay Marion Niemi in Detroit, MI. Growing up in St. Clair Shores and Fair Haven, Jeffrey established his love for boating early on Lake St Clair. He went on to serve his country in the Army, stationed in Germany. Jeffrey spent decades running his residential and commercial painting company servicing southwest Florida. His hard work ethic and drive for success in business set a priceless example for his Children to excel . He enjoyed traveling and taking his motorhome around the country. He was especially fond of Yellowstone National Park where he and his wife Anna spent 9 years taking in the beauty. Jeffrey was full of knowledge, the unofficial record holder for reading owner manuals cover to cover. This was a running joke with those around him; however, his drive to gather information gave him the ability to work on and fix just about anything. He was always the one that people called upon for advice or assistance to fix things. He was an empathic person who would always lend a hand to anyone in need. He loved to tinker which led to his hobby of working on and restoring pinball machines in his spare time. Jeffrey’s sense of humor was the gift that kept giving, as each day with him was truly a gift. He loved his life and his family. He will be deeply missed and his legacy will live on through his loved ones that he filled with knowledge and wisdom .

Jeffrey is survived by his wife, Anna Marie Niemi; his sister, Roberta Lynn Morgan; his three children, Jeffrey Thomas Niemi, Jacklynn Rosemarie Falzon and Michael William Niemi; along with his 7 grandchildren and counting. He was predeceased by his parents, Albert Thomas and Kay Marion Niemi
